The Legacy of Maggie Beer in Australian Cuisine

Introduction
Maggie Beer is a name synonymous with Australian gastronomic excellence. As a pioneer in the world of gourmet food, her contributions to the culinary scene have not only popularised local ingredients but have also helped refine the appreciation for Australian cuisine. Beer, a chef, author, and food entrepreneur, has made significant strides in advocating for the use of fresh, seasonal produce, making her one of the most influential figures in the industry.
Career Highlights
Born in 1944 in Sydney, Maggie’s journey into the culinary world began in the 1970s when she started her own gourmet food business in the Barossa Valley. Her career took a turn when she launched a successful range of sauces and condiments that celebrated the produce of South Australia. This led to the establishment of Maggie Beer Products, which became widely popular across Australia.
In addition to her product line, Beer is a celebrated author, having penned numerous cookbooks that highlight her passion for food and the importance of quality ingredients. One of her most notable contributions is the ‘Maggie Beer Foundation,’ aimed at enriching the lives of older Australians through food, which underscores her belief in the power of nutrition and culinary enjoyment.
